This Fine Art Print of Jimi Hendrix at the June 16, 1967 Monterey Pop Festival was taken by famed rock & roll photographer Jim Marshall. DESCRIPTION Thisshot was taken during a sound check at the Monterey Pop Festival, 1967.Hendrix was playing to an empty arena - or, more accurately, to himself. I was one of the official photographers and, for some reason, everyone was at dinner except for Al Kooper, Jimi's band and crew, and some other stagehands. I approached Jimi and told him that my name was Jim Marshall - that I was one of the photographers. He made some comment like, "Far out, man, maybe this sh*t is supposed to be," and I asked him what he meant. He said that the dude who made his amps was named Jim Marshall, and smart-a*s me says, "Yeah, I know that." But then he said, "What you don't know is that my middle name is Marshall."
